BACKGROUND Capital Camps & Retreat Center (CCRC), a non-profit Jewish camping and retreat organization, is seeking a full-time Development Associate to join its development department. AGENCY OVERVIEW CCRC provides enriching, summer overnight camp and year-round retreat services to children, families and organizations primarily from the Washington D.C., Maryland and Virginia areas. The agency’s office is located in Rockville, MD, and the camp and retreat center are located in Waynesboro, PA. Founded in 1987, Capital Camps has enjoyed steady growth and is now close to capacity each summer with children ages eight to 17 on a sprawling renovated campus in the Catoctin Mountains. The Retreat Center, which hosts approximately 100 groups each year, is a center of learning and rejuvenation for adults, families, and organizations. POSITION OVERVIEW CCRC seeks a dynamic Development Associate to join its development team and to support its fundraising, volunteer, and alumni engagement efforts. The Development Associate will work in direct partnership with the Development Director to continue to elevate the agency’s development program and its system for securing and growing support, while creating a positive culture of philanthropy and engagement within the CCRC community. This role ensures smooth data management, strong donor relations, and operational efficiencies to advance CCRC’s goals for maximizing philanthropic giving. Responsibilities Manage the agency’s development database (Raiser’s Edge), including management of constituent information gathered from other CCRC databases. Enter gifts and reconcile pledges/donations with finance team. Manage mailings and email lists, including solicitations, acknowledgements, and receipting. Prepare data reports for the Development Director and CEO, Development Committee and Board of Directors, as well as for targeted communications, events, stewardship, and cultivation. Work with Development Director to build a portfolio of parents, alumni and community members to steward and solicit to support CCRC’s Annual Campaign. Partner with the marketing team to give a consistent voice to e-communications and social media posts to donors and community members, including writing, image selection and regular cadences for different constituencies. Assist with the implementation of CCRC’s development plan through multiple cultivation & stewardship outreach efforts. Activate alumni networks through consistent engagement, communication, events, and solicitations. Support grant research, writing and proposal preparation. Play an active role in planning and executing summer camp visits for prospects and donors. Compensation

$43,000 – $50,000, commensurate with experience, alongside an attractive and competitive package. Requirements

Qualifications Bachelor’s Degree 2-3 years of development/fundraising experience Dynamic, energetic and exceptionally detail-oriented Desire to join a robust team and grow philanthropic support Outstanding interpersonal and relationship-building skills Excellent data analysis, written and verbal communication skills Highly organized, capable of responding efficiently and effectively to a variety of requests Excellent proficiency with database management and Microsoft Office products Committed to an ongoing process of growth and development Familiarity with Jewish culture, traditions and community Ability to staff occasional evening and weekend programs within the catchment area.
